What Are PhonePe Gift Cards?
PhonePe, one of India’s leading digital payment platforms, offers gift cards that can be used for shopping, food delivery, fuel, and more. These cards are typically bought by individuals or companies for gifting purposes, cashback rewards, or promotional campaigns.
They are legit and safe when purchased through authorized sources like the PhonePe app, Flipkart, or select partners.

The Unlimited Gift Card Hype
The concept of “unlimited PhonePe gift cards” gained traction through:
-
YouTube tutorials claiming to reveal secret methods
-
Telegram and WhatsApp links promising free cards
-
Fake websites mimicking PhonePe’s interface
-
Referral scams asking people to download apps or enter OTPs
These posts often use edited screenshots, fake proofs of balance, and urgent language (“last day offer,” “limited time hack”) to lure users in.
The Reality Check
Here’s the truth: There is no official or legal way to generate unlimited PhonePe gift cards.
These scams often lead to:
-
Phishing: Sites that steal your personal or banking information
-
Malware: Apps that infect your device and track sensitive data
-
Loss of Money: Some users are asked to pay small “verification fees” and never receive anything in return
-
Account bans: Using illegal methods can get your PhonePe account suspended permanently
PhonePe’s Official Stance
PhonePe has repeatedly warned users through its help center and social media channels not to trust third-party sources or “free gift card” schemes. The platform advises:
-
Only trust offers visible within the PhonePe app
-
Never share OTPs or passwords with anyone
-
Report suspicious activity or links to customer support
